Output 86668b94d02f158dd9f9c51606f3111701e268b766e75acc8df225083e7e17f0:0

value
666927
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e61f0bac3fa9c8515cc646b7051f72cfa9939926 OP_EQUALVERIFY OP_CHECKSIG
address
1MymcCzzwYxEVTsD3t6sZvTBKqNtLA4wqZ
transaction
86668b94d02f158dd9f9c51606f3111701e268b766e75acc8df225083e7e17f0
spent
true